How Rooflights Increase Energy Efficiency
Optimizing natural light via rooflights not only benefits interior comfort but also substantially contributes to energy efficiency. By allowing sunlight to filter through spaces, rooflights can minimize the dependence on artificial lighting during the day. This natural lighting reduces energy consumption, resulting in lower utility bills. Additionally, many contemporary rooflights are fitted with energy-efficient glazing, which can help regulate indoor temperatures. By limiting heat loss in winter and reducing heat gain in summer, these installations establish a more comfortable living environment while lowering heating and cooling demands. The strategic placement of rooflights can also promote cross-ventilation, further enhancing air quality and minimizing the need for mechanical ventilation systems. Overall, integrating rooflights into architectural designs not only lights up interiors but is fundamental to fostering a more eco-friendly and energy-conscious home.

Pick the Suitable Glass Type
Selecting the appropriate glass type for rooflights significantly impacts both visual appeal and performance. A range of options, such as double-glazed, triple-glazed, and laminated glass, offer specific advantages. Double glazing provides superior insulation and reduces heat loss, while triple-glazed glass boosts energy performance, making it well-suited for colder climates. Laminated glazing, by contrast, delivers added security and sound insulation, which is particularly advantageous in urban areas.
Furthermore, choosing low-emissivity (Low-E) glass can reduce ultraviolet radiation and glare, preventing interior fading. Assessing safety ratings, as well as the capacity of the glass to withstand impact or extreme weather, is also vital. Ultimately, opting for the right glass option guarantees that rooflights satisfy particular requirements while enhancing overall comfort and aesthetic appeal.
Frequent Issues and Answers for Rooflight Installations
While rooflight installations provide considerable advantages, such as enhanced natural light and energy efficiency, certain issues may emerge throughout the process. A prevalent problem is the potential for leaks, typically caused by incorrect installation or insufficient sealing. To prevent this, working with qualified professionals and selecting superior materials is vital.
A further consideration is thermal buildup during the warmer months, which can lead to elevated energy bills for cooling. This can be mitigated by selecting high-performance glass solutions or including shading systems.
In addition, householders may have concerns about the integrity of their roof structure. Making sure the roof is capable of bearing the extra weight of rooflights is of great importance, often necessitating advice from a structural engineer.
Lastly, privacy concerns may arise when rooflights overlook surrounding homes. Thoughtfully situating rooflights or selecting opaque glass can minimize this issue. By handling these challenges ahead of time, residents are able to experience the full advantages of installing rooflights.

Consistent Cleaning Schedule
A structured cleaning programme is key to maintaining the performance and transparency of rooflights. Routine maintenance not only improves the visual appearance but also ensures optimal natural light transmission. Dust, pollutants, and organic matter can collect over time, hindering light flow and potentially compromising the rooflight structure. It is advisable to clean rooflights at least twice a year, with additional cleanings after severe weather events. Using a soft cloth and a mild, non-abrasive cleaner can effectively remove grime without scratching the surface. Residents should remain mindful of nearby areas to stop overgrown foliage or external obstructions from reducing light entry. Adhering to a regular cleaning routine will prolong the lifespan of rooflights and maintain their efficiency in illuminating interior spaces.
Inspect Seals Periodically
Regular cleaning helps maintain rooflights, but another essential aspect is the periodic inspection of seals. Seals play a crucial role in keeping water out and maintaining energy efficiency. As time passes, environmental conditions can deteriorate seals, resulting in leaks and higher energy expenses. Seals consult this source should ideally be inspected a minimum of twice annually, especially following harsh weather conditions. Evidence of wear, such as cracks or openings, should be tackled without delay to avert more substantial complications. Professional assessments can provide insights into the condition of the seals and recommend necessary repairs or replacements. By prioritizing seal inspections, homeowners can extend the lifespan of their rooflights and maintain a comfortable indoor environment.
